GCMS notes & refusal recovery
- File ATIP request to retrieve officer notes (30–40 days).
- Identify refusal ground: purpose, funds, ties, misrepresentation, or medical.
- Rebuild evidence targeting each note.
- Choose reconsideration (14 days, procedural), fresh application, or Federal Court judicial review with RCIC partner.
- Re-submit with a purpose letter mapped to Reg. 179 requirements.
FAQ
- TRV, Study Permit or Work Permit?
- TRV (Temporary Resident Visa) covers tourism, family visit, short business — up to 6 months per entry, single or multiple. Study Permit needs a Letter of Acceptance from a DLI (Designated Learning Institution). Work Permit needs either an LMIA-backed job offer or LMIA-exempt category (intra-company transfer, IMP).
- How long from Bangkok?
- TRV IRCC processing target 30–60 days for Thailand nationals (visa-required). Study Permit 8–12 weeks. Work Permit 8–20 weeks depending on LMIA status. Biometrics at VFS Canada (Chamchuri Square, Silom) within 30 days of the request letter.
- What is the Strong Buyer / dual intent issue for Thai applicants?
- IRCC officers look for genuine temporary intent (proof of return). Common refusal grounds: insufficient ties to Thailand, purpose of visit not credible, financial capacity unclear. We pre-empt this with a bilingual purpose letter, six-month bank flow, employment continuity, and property/family ties documentation.

- Refusal handling?
- Canada does not offer a formal appeal for TRV refusals. Options: (1) reconsideration request within 14 days if procedural error, (2) fresh application addressing GCMS notes (we retrieve notes via ATIP), (3) Federal Court judicial review for serious errors — we coordinate with a Canadian-licensed RCIC partner.

Frequently asked questions
- What is the DTV and who realistically qualifies?
- The Destination Thailand Visa is a five-year multiple-entry visa allowing stays of up to 180 days per entry, extendable once per entry by a further 180 days at an immigration office. It targets remote workers employed or contracted outside Thailand, freelancers with foreign clients, and participants in Thai soft-power activities such as Muay Thai training, cooking courses or medical treatment, and it requires evidence of at least THB 500,000 in available funds.
- How is the LTR visa different from the DTV?
- The Long-Term Resident visa is a ten-year visa administered by the Board of Investment for wealthy global citizens, wealthy pensioners, work-from-Thailand professionals and highly skilled professionals, and it bundles a digital work permit, a flat 17% personal income tax rate for the skilled-professional category and annual instead of 90-day reporting. The DTV is cheaper and faster but grants no work permit for Thai-sourced work and no tax privileges.
- Can I work in Thailand on a tourist or DTV visa?
- No — any work performed inside Thailand requires a work permit or an equivalent digital work authorization, regardless of where the employer or client is located. The DTV is intended for work delivered to foreign employers and clients; taking on Thai clients or a Thai employer requires switching to a Non-B or LTR pathway with proper authorization.
- What most often causes a Schengen or UK visa refusal from Thailand?
- The dominant causes are weak evidence of ties to Thailand, bank statements that show a sudden unexplained deposit shortly before filing, inconsistencies between the application form and supporting documents, insufficient or non-compliant travel insurance, and an itinerary that does not match the stated purpose. Refusals are recorded, so a re-application must directly address the refusal ground rather than simply resubmit the same file.
